### Step 4: Upgrade the Quillbus broker

Drain consumers on each Quillbus node before upgrading; the new wire protocol is not backward compatible mid-stream. Upgrade followers first, then the leader, then re-enable producers. New team members: verify queue depth returns to zero before proceeding. After the upgrade, apply the broker configuration below.

config for kawif-hahig:
zorix:
  log_level: error
  metrics_host: metrics.zorix.lumiclabs.internal
  pool_size: 16

**Mgmt Meeting Minutes — Retiring the Brightline Range**

Quick recap for sales leads at Fenholt Supplies: we agreed to retire the Brightline fixture range by year-end. Remaining stock moves to clearance pricing next month, and accounts on standing orders get migrated to the Lumetta range. Trade-in incentives were approved in principle. The confidential note on next steps sits just below.

board note of bajof-bajeg: The pricing group signed off on a budget of $13.4 million for Project Sildor. The renewal with Lamixek Holdings closes at $48.9 million a year, 49 percent above the last contract.

**Vendor note: Inkmill markdown pipeline**

Rendering for Parchway docs is outsourced to Inkmill under an annual contract, renewing each March. They handle sanitization and PDF export; we own the upload queue. SLA: 4-hour response on rendering failures. Escalate only after two failed retries. Their support desk is reachable at the address below.

billing contact of hahaf-baguf = zorael.tammir.jorius@sivrelhq.internal